#e4900e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e4900e is composed of 89.4% red, 56.5% green and 5.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 36.8% magenta, 93.9% yellow and 10.6% black. It has a hue angle of 36.4 degrees, a saturation of 88.4% and a lightness of 47.5%. #e4900e color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ff1c with #c92100. Closest websafe color is: #cc9900.

Shades and Tints of #e4900e
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060400 is the darkest color, while #fefaf3 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e4900e
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7e7a74 is the less saturated color, while #ed9205 is the most saturated one.
